The main characteristics of ergonomic office furniture
Ergonomic office desks and chairs are one of the most important pieces of furniture in any workspace. These chairs are designed to provide appropriate lumbar support, adjustable height, and tilt options to ensure employees maintain a healthy posture throughout the day.
A height adjustable office desk is also essential for ergonomic workstations. They allow employees to switch between sitting and standing positions, which can improve blood circulation and reduce the risk of back pain.
In addition to chairs and tables, ergonomic accessories such as keyboard trays, monitor stands, and foot pedals can further enhance employee comfort and productivity.
Choose suitable ergonomic office furniture for your business
When choosing ergonomic office furniture for your business, it is important to consider the specific needs of employees and workspace. Thoroughly evaluate your work environment to determine the type of furniture that best supports employee tasks and postures.
Find furniture that is adjustable, durable, and easy to maintain. High quality materials and construction will ensure that your investment lasts for many years.
